.style_pricing-section__ReP8j{border:2px solid #000;border-radius:8px;padding:30px;margin:30px 0;background:#fff}.style_pricing-header__egQRD{text-align:center;margin-bottom:30px}.style_pricing-header__egQRD h3{font-size:24px;font-weight:700;margin:0}.style_pricing-content__nYBUW{display:grid;grid-gap:20px;gap:20px}.style_pricing-item__Mn2HE{display:flex;justify-content:space-between;align-items:center;padding:10px 0;border-bottom:1px solid #eee}.style_pricing-label__12zQB{font-weight:500}.style_pricing-value__6SOX4{display:flex;align-items:baseline;gap:5px;white-space:nowrap}.style_price-amount__19jlJ{font-size:32px;font-weight:700;color:#e74c3c}.style_tax-included__1m6eo{font-size:.9rem;color:#666}.style_pricing-notes__uVUF7{margin-top:20px;padding-top:15px;border-top:1px solid #eee;font-size:.85rem;color:#666;line-height:1.5}.style_pricing-notes__uVUF7 p{margin:0 0 10px}.style_pricing-notes__uVUF7 p:last-child{margin-bottom:0}@media only screen and (max-width:768px){.style_pricing-section__ReP8j{padding:20px;margin:20px 0}.style_pricing-item__Mn2HE{flex-direction:column;align-items:flex-start;gap:5px}.style_pricing-value__6SOX4{width:100%;justify-content:flex-start}.style_price-amount__19jlJ{font-size:24px}.style_pricing-notes__uVUF7{font-size:.8rem}}.style_school-card__a0hVu{position:relative}.style_school-card__a0hVu p{margin:0;padding:0}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_{text-decoration:none;background:#fff;border-radius:10px;padding:20px;display:block;font-weight:700}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_profile___e8SL{margin-top:10px;display:flex;align-items:center}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_profile-name__riJvX{margin-left:10px;font-size:16px}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_title__9Ev0j{margin-top:20px;font-size:16px}.style_school-card__a0hVu .style_is-member-only-overlay__ckI1Z{width:100%;height:100%;background:rgba(0,0,0,.7);position:absolute;top:0;left:0;z-index:2;color:#fff;display:flex;flex-direction:column;align-items:center;justify-content:center;font-size:20px;line-height:1.28;font-weight:700;text-align:center}.style_school-card__a0hVu .style_is-member-only-overlay__ckI1Z:before{content:"";display:block;width:52px;height:68px;background:url(/images/manabiya_member_only.png) no-repeat 50%/contain;margin-bottom:15px}@media only screen and (max-width:768px){.style_school-card__a0hVu .style_school-card-wrapper__uuKY_{display:flex;width:100%;padding:15px;gap:15px;border:1px solid #000;border-radius:5px}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_profile___e8SL{margin-top:0}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_school-thumbnail__f4_LC{width:150px}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_profile-icon__H7xN7{width:30px;height:30px}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_profile-icon__H7xN7:nth-child(n+2){width:20px;height:20px}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_content__utrOm{display:flex;flex-direction:column-reverse;justify-content:space-between}.style_school-card__a0hVu .style_school-card-wrapper__uuKY_ .style_title__9Ev0j{margin-top:5px;font-size:14px;display:-webkit-box;-webkit-line-clamp:3;line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.style_school-card__a0hVu .style_is-member-only-overlay__ckI1Z{border-radius:5px;font-size:14px}.style_school-card__a0hVu .style_is-member-only-overlay__ckI1Z br{display:none}.style_school-card__a0hVu .style_is-member-only-overlay__ckI1Z:before{margin-bottom:8px;width:26px;height:34px}}.style_list-content__r6N8A{display:flex;flex-wrap:wrap}.style_list-item__RTua3{width:48%;height:1%;border:3px solid #000;border-radius:10px}.style_list-item__RTua3:nth-child(odd){margin-right:4%}.style_list-item__RTua3:nth-child(n+3){margin-top:30px}@media only screen and (max-width:768px){.style_list-content__r6N8A{display:grid;grid-gap:20px;gap:20px}.style_list-item__RTua3{width:100%;height:100%}.style_list-item__RTua3:nth-child(odd){margin-right:0}.style_list-item__RTua3:nth-child(n+3){margin-top:0}}.style_review-button-container__ZoIof{margin:20px 0}